Which side of the plane to sit from Zakynthos International Airport "Dionysios Solomos (Zakynthos) to London Gatwick Airport (London)?
Right Side of the Plane
The right side of the aircraft offers an unparalleled panorama of the European continent, including the dramatic central spine of the Italian Apennines and the most iconic peaks of the high Alps as you transit toward London.
Apennine Mountains
The rugged 'spine' of Italy, featuring deep limestone gorges and high mountain villages.
The High Alps
Breathtaking views of the snow-capped Swiss and French Alps, often passing near the Mont Blanc massif.
Lake Geneva
The distinctive crescent shape of Lake Geneva and the surrounding Jura mountains are often visible.
Parisian Basin
The vast, organized agricultural patterns and urban sprawl of the Greater Paris region as you head toward the coast.
South Downs
During the descent into Gatwick, enjoy the rolling green hills and historic estates of the Sussex countryside.
The right side is essential for mountain lovers. You will get the best angle of the Alps approximately 90-120 minutes into the flight. For the most dramatic lighting, choose a morning flight when the sun illuminates the eastern slopes of the mountains. Ensure your window is clean, as the high-altitude Alpine views are the highlight of this route.
Ionian Coastline
Stunning views of the Zakynthos cliffs and the deep blue waters of the Ionian Sea immediately after departure.
Tyrrhenian Sea & Vesuvius
On clear days, see the Italian western coastline and the silhouette of Mount Vesuvius near Naples.
Massif Central
The ancient, rolling volcanic plateaus of south-central France provide a rugged green landscape.
English Channel
A bird's-eye view of the world's busiest shipping lanes and the white cliffs of the French coast near Dieppe.
Sit on the left if you prefer coastal views and want to avoid the direct afternoon sun on flights heading North-West. It is the best side for viewing the initial ascent over the turquoise waters of the shipwreck island. For photography, use a polarizing filter to cut through the haze over the Mediterranean.
